Legendary Entertainment is a leading media company with film (Legendary Pictures), television and digital (Legendary Television and Digital Media) and comics (Legendary Comics) divisions dedicated to owning, producing, and delivering content to worldwide audiences. Legendary has built a library of marquee media properties and has established itself as a trusted brand that consistently delivers high-quality, commercial entertainment including some of the world's most popular intellectual property. In aggregate, Legendary Pictures-associated productions have realized grosses of more than $20 billion worldwide at the box office. To learn more visit: www.legendary.com.


Our part-time, paid internship program provides hands-on experience in a dynamic, innovative environment within the entertainment industry. Interns can work up to 29 hours per week with a flexible schedule to accommodate academic commitments. Participants will engage in real projects, gaining practical industry insights while developing professional skills through workshops and career-building sessions. The program also features guest speaker events with industry experts, networking opportunities with professionals and fellow interns, and exclusive perks such as company outings, team-building activities, and access to film and media screenings.


Summary


Legendary is currently seeking an intern to assist the TV Development Team. The internship will give you first-hand experience of how a TV development team works within a studio. The intern will be exposed to the development process at all stages and will have the opportunity to learn from all members of the creative team. During the program, interns will have face time with supervisors daily to discuss assignments, get feedback on their work, and ask questions about development and the industry. In addition, the intern will work closely with the executives and members of the team.


Responsibilities

  • In-depth coverage of incoming material.
  • Research on development projects, potential IP, etc.
  • Provide notes and creative feedback on scripts in active development.
  • Update internal lists, databases, and grids used by the creative team.
